Image of Neotorularia torulosa (Desf.) Hedge & J. Léonard

Description:

This is a shy desert annual plant. It produces first a leaf rosette and a cluster of dense flower in the middle (as u see in the pic). If there is additional rain it will develop a stem with more flowers, if not the exsisting flowers will fruit and the plant will dry out. This flexibility is typical to many other desert annuals.
